Training Modules
Equality diversity and inclusion [EDI] training modules for staff.
Equality and Diversity Essentials
An online training course to increase your knowledge and understanding of EDI - required to be taken by all staff
Challenging Unconscious Bias
This course explores what Unconscious Bias (UB) is, what it means, and how it impacts on the people around us in the workplace - required to be taken by all staff
Union Black:Britain's Black Cultures and Steps to Anti-Racism
This course explores Britain's Black Cultures and how to be a change agent for EDI and belonging.
Implementing Reasonable Adjustments for Staff
This course will help you to understand disability, and identify how reasonable adjustments can be made in the workplace for staff with disabilities
Mental Health Awareness
This course highlights ways to be aware of your own mental health and to offer support to colleagues
Introducing Equality Impact Assessments
This course will take you through how to complete an EqIA.
Courses: Consent Matters and Tackling Harassment
These courses provide information about the importance of sexual consent, recognizing harassment and how you can look out for others.
Gender Diversity Awareness Training for Employers and Service Providers (secured)
This e-Learning course is provided by GIRES - Gender Identity Research & Education Society.
